You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@maven.apache.org by sl...@apache.org on 2021/09/29 14:06:11 UTC

[maven-dependency-plugin] 01/01: [MDEP-769] remove final modifier from mojo parameter

This is an automated email from the ASF dual-hosted git repository.

slachiewicz pushed a commit to branch MDEP-769-final
in repository https://gitbox.apache.org/repos/asf/maven-dependency-plugin.git

commit 76d5463d4933c878e1fa33091a230a03c6b15924
Author: Slawomir Jaranowski <s....@gmail.com>
AuthorDate: Mon Sep 13 23:44:50 2021 +0200

    [MDEP-769] remove final modifier from mojo parameter
---
 .../maven/plugins/dependency/analyze/AbstractAnalyzeMojo.java       | 6 +++---
 .../apache/maven/plugins/dependency/fromConfiguration/CopyMojo.java | 2 +-
 .../plugins/dependency/fromDependencies/BuildClasspathMojo.java     | 4 ++--
 3 files changed, 6 insertions(+), 6 deletions(-)

diff --git a/src/main/java/org/apache/maven/plugins/dependency/analyze/AbstractAnalyzeMojo.java b/src/main/java/org/apache/maven/plugins/dependency/analyze/AbstractAnalyzeMojo.java
index 6ab8073..d2bb601 100644
--- a/src/main/java/org/apache/maven/plugins/dependency/analyze/AbstractAnalyzeMojo.java
+++ b/src/main/java/org/apache/maven/plugins/dependency/analyze/AbstractAnalyzeMojo.java
@@ -182,7 +182,7 @@ public abstract class AbstractAnalyzeMojo
      * @since 2.10
      */
     @Parameter
-    private final String[] ignoredDependencies = new String[0];
+    private String[] ignoredDependencies = new String[0];
 
     /**
      * List of dependencies that will be ignored if they are used but undeclared. The filter syntax is:
@@ -201,7 +201,7 @@ public abstract class AbstractAnalyzeMojo
      * @since 2.10
      */
     @Parameter
-    private final String[] ignoredUsedUndeclaredDependencies = new String[0];
+    private String[] ignoredUsedUndeclaredDependencies = new String[0];
 
     /**
      * List of dependencies that will be ignored if they are declared but unused. The filter syntax is:
@@ -220,7 +220,7 @@ public abstract class AbstractAnalyzeMojo
      * @since 2.10
      */
     @Parameter
-    private final String[] ignoredUnusedDeclaredDependencies = new String[0];
+    private String[] ignoredUnusedDeclaredDependencies = new String[0];
 
     // Mojo methods -----------------------------------------------------------
 
diff --git a/src/main/java/org/apache/maven/plugins/dependency/fromConfiguration/CopyMojo.java b/src/main/java/org/apache/maven/plugins/dependency/fromConfiguration/CopyMojo.java
index bebe5f4..e95d350 100644
--- a/src/main/java/org/apache/maven/plugins/dependency/fromConfiguration/CopyMojo.java
+++ b/src/main/java/org/apache/maven/plugins/dependency/fromConfiguration/CopyMojo.java
@@ -59,7 +59,7 @@ public class CopyMojo
      * @since 2.7
      */
     @Parameter( property = "mdep.prependGroupId", defaultValue = "false" )
-    private final boolean prependGroupId = false;
+    private boolean prependGroupId = false;
 
     /**
      * Use artifact baseVersion during copy
diff --git a/src/main/java/org/apache/maven/plugins/dependency/fromDependencies/BuildClasspathMojo.java b/src/main/java/org/apache/maven/plugins/dependency/fromDependencies/BuildClasspathMojo.java
index bcb6dac..4a4176a 100644
--- a/src/main/java/org/apache/maven/plugins/dependency/fromDependencies/BuildClasspathMojo.java
+++ b/src/main/java/org/apache/maven/plugins/dependency/fromDependencies/BuildClasspathMojo.java
@@ -78,7 +78,7 @@ public class BuildClasspathMojo
      * Strip artifact classifier during copy (only works if prefix is set)
      */
     @Parameter( property = "mdep.stripClassifier", defaultValue = "false" )
-    private final boolean stripClassifier = false;
+    private boolean stripClassifier = false;
 
     /**
      * The prefix to prepend on each dependent artifact. If undefined, the paths refer to the actual files store in the
@@ -158,7 +158,7 @@ public class BuildClasspathMojo
      * @since 2.6
      */
     @Parameter( property = "mdep.useBaseVersion", defaultValue = "true" )
-    private final boolean useBaseVersion = true;
+    private boolean useBaseVersion = true;
 
     /**
      * Maven ProjectHelper